Key Ingredients and Their Benefits




Adivasi hair oil is composed of several powerful herbs and natural extracts known for their favorable impacts on hair wellness:

Bhringraj: Often referred to as the "king of herbs" for hair, Bhringraj is believed to promote hair growth, strengthen hair follicles, and prevent premature graying.

Brahmi: This herb is known to nourish the scalp, strengthen blood vessels, and improve blood flow, which can bring about reduced hair autumn and enhanced hair growth.

Amla (Indian Gooseberry): Rich in vitamin C and anti-oxidants, Amla strengthens hair follicles, avoids dandruff, and includes luster to the hair.

Coconut Oil: Known for its deep conditioning properties, coconut oil penetrates the hair shaft, reducing protein loss and providing moisture to dry hair.

Aloe Vera: With its soothing and moisturizing properties, Aloe Vera helps maintain the pH equilibrium of the scalp, reduces dandruff, and promotes healthy and balanced hair growth.

Kapoor (Camphor): Camphor has antimicrobial properties that can help in treating scalp infections and reducing itchiness, promoting a healthier scalp atmosphere.

These ingredients function synergistically to address various hair concerns, making Adivasi hair oil a comprehensive remedy for those looking for natural hair care remedies.

How to Use Adivasi Hair Oil

To maximize the benefits of Adivasi hair oil, follow these steps:

Application: Take a small amount of oil in your palm and cozy it by massaging your hands with each other. Carefully massage it into your scalp using circular motions, ensuring also circulation.

Massage: Continue rubbing for 5-10 mins to enhance blood circulation to the hair follicles.

Saturating Period: Leave the oil on for a minimum of 2 hours, or preferably over night, to enable deep penetration into the scalp and hair shafts.

Washing: Wash your hair with a moderate, sulfate-free hair shampoo to get rid of the oil. You may require to hair shampoo two times to guarantee all deposit is eliminated.

Regularity: For optimum outcomes, use the oil 2-3 times a week consistently.
